Turning the clockdisplay

on or off

You can turn the clock display on or off.

% Press CLOCK to turn the clock display

on or off.

Each press of CLOCK turns the clock display

on or off.

# The clock display disappears temporarily
when you perform other operations, but the clock
display appears again after 25 seconds.

Note

Even when the sources are off, the clock display
appears on the display. Pressing CLOCK turns
the clock display on or off.

Setting the level indicator

These are two stored level indicator to select

from.

% Press EQ and hold to select the level in-

dicator.

Press EQ and hold repeatedly to switch be-

tween the following settings:

Level indicator 1Level indicator 2Level in-

dicator fullLevel indicator off

Note

When the optical inputs 1 and 2 on DEQ-P7650
are occupied and AUX is connected to this unit,
the level indicators may be incorrectly dis-
played.

Using the AUX source

An IP-BUS-RCA Interconnector such as the

CD-RB20/CD-RB10 (sold separately) lets you

connect this unit to auxiliary equipment fea-

turing RCA output. For more details, refer to

the IP-BUS-RCA Interconnector owners man-

ual.

Selecting AUX as the source

% Press SOURCE to select AUX as the

source.

Press SOURCE until AUX appears in the dis-

play.

# If the auxiliary setting is not turned on, AUX
cannot be selected. For more details, see Switch-
ing the auxiliary setting on page 82.

Setting the AUX title

The title displayed for the AUX source can be

changed.

1 After you have selected AUX as the

source, press F and hold until TITLE IN ap-

pears in the display.

2 Press r or q to select a letter of the

alphabet.

Each press of r will display a letter of the al-

phabet in A B C ... X Y Z, numbers and sym-

bols in 1 2 3 ... > [ ] order. Each press of q

will display a letter in the reverse order, such

as Z Y X ... C B A order.

3 Press n to move the cursor to the

next character position.

When the letter you want is displayed, press

n to move the cursor to the next position

and then select the next letter. Press m to

move backwards in the display.
